One of the standout benefits of using a High Solid Content PU Curing Agent is its ability to enhance the durability of coatings and finishes. According to John Reynolds, a materials engineer, “These curing agents create a more robust crosslinking structure, leading to products that withstand various environmental stressors significantly better than those made with traditional agents.” This durability ensures long-lasting applications in demanding conditions.
High Solid Content PU Curing Agents also provide exceptional chemical resistance. Dr. Sarah Liu, a chemical process specialist, notes, “The high solid content formulation helps create a dense film that resists degradation from solvents and harsh chemicals.” This quality is particularly beneficial in industrial settings where exposure to aggressive substances is common.
With increasing regulations on volatile organic compounds (VOCs), the use of High Solid Content PU Curing Agents can help projects remain compliant. Environmental consultant Mark Henderson states, “These curing agents typically emit lower VOCs, making them a more environmentally friendly alternative without sacrificing performance.” This compliance is crucial for companies looking to adhere to sustainability goals.
Utilizing High Solid Content PU Curing Agents can also lead to significant cost savings. Experts like financial analyst Anna Gomez point out, “The higher solids content means that less material is needed to achieve the desired thickness and performance. This reduction in material usage directly translates to lower costs in the long run.”

Another advantage is the quicker curing times associated with High Solid Content PU Curing Agents. As construction manager David Ortiz explains, “Quicker curing means faster turnaround times for projects, allowing contractors to meet tight deadlines without sacrificing quality.” This efficiency is a major draw for those in fast-paced industries.
These curing agents are incredibly versatile, making them suitable for a wide range of applications. As polyurethanes expert Emma Tran describes, “Whether it’s in coatings, adhesives, or sealants, High Solid Content PU Curing Agents provide excellent performance across different substrates.” This adaptability simplifies the selection of materials for diverse projects.
Finally, the aesthetic quality achieved with High Solid Content PU Curing Agents cannot be overstated. Product designer Laura Kim highlights, “These agents not only enhance the visual appeal of surfaces due to their glossy finish but also contribute to a functional layer that protects against scratches and stains.” A combination of beauty and functionality is often the deciding factor for many clients.
